Chief Minister Yogi Adityanath is contemplating the implementation of Master Plan 2031 for the comprehensive development of various districts in Uttar Pradesh. This visionary plan, discussed during a meeting at the Chief Minister's official residence, signifies a strategic effort to propel the state's progress through well-structured and forward-looking urban and infrastructure planning.

The Master Plan 2031 is envisioned as a roadmap for the overall development and transformation of districts in Uttar Pradesh. With a focus on strategic urban infrastructure, the plan aims to address evolving challenges, accommodate population growth, and create sustainable urban spaces. CM Yogi's consideration of this plan reflects a commitment to fostering balanced and inclusive development across the state.

As Uttar Pradesh seeks to position itself as a leader in economic and infrastructural development, the Master Plan 2031 emerges as a pivotal initiative to guide growth. CM Yogi's engagement with this forward-looking plan underscores the government's dedication to harnessing strategic planning and urban development to uplift the living standards and opportunities for the people of Uttar Pradesh.

Redevelopment 2.0

In 2017, Mumbai identified 160,000 ageing buildings due for structural audit. Close to half of these were in the Western Suburbs. Redeveloping the oldest and structurally weakest of these would help unlock new housing, much needed given the city’s growing population density and constant developed area of 437.7 sq km. At 30,600 people per sq km in 2024, Mumbai’s density was almost thrice that of Gurugram, and 60 per cent higher than Bengaluru’s.Essentially, Mumbai’s realty market has demand. It has capital.
